软件测试中bug的定义

发表于:2011-07-12来源:未知作者:领测软件测试网采编点击数: 标签:软件测试
bug 就是软件测试中的错误。 一 。bug可以多种类型。 1.按照严重程度进行划分。 是指bug对软件质量的破坏程度。即此bug的存在将对软件的功能和性能产生什么样的影响。按照严重程度由高到低的顺序可以分为5个等级:系统崩溃,严重后果,

  bug 就是软件测试中的错误。

  一 。bug可以多种类型。

  1.按照严重程度进行划分。

  是指bug对软件质量的破坏程度。即此bug的存在将对软件的功能和性能产生什么样的影响。按照严重程度由高到低的顺序可以分为5个等级:系统崩溃,严重后果,一般,次要,建议。在具体的项目中要根据实际的情况来划分等级,如果bug数量较少就可以划分3个等级:严重,一般,次要。

  2.按优先级划分。

  表示处理和修正软件bug的先后顺序的指标。即那些bug需要优先修正。哪些bug可以稍后进行修改。按照优先级可以划分3个等级:严重,一般,次要。

  二。bug说明

  一般地,严重程度较高的bug具有较高的优先级。严重程度高的说明bug对软件造成的质量危害性大需要先处理,而严重程度较低的bug可能只是软件不太尽善尽美。

  一。。但是严重程度高的bug优先级是不一定高的。比如:1.某个bug只在非常极端的条件下才会产生,没有必要立即解决。

  2.如果修正一个软件bug需要重新修改软件的整体架构。可能会产生更多潜在的bug而软件由于市场的压力必须尽快发布,即使bug的严重性很高,是否需要修正。需要全盘考虑。

  二。。严重程度较低的不一定优先级就低。比如:软件名称或公司名称的拼写错误。虽然说是属于界面错误。严重错误不高。但是关系到软件和公司的市场和形象,必须尽快修正。

原文转自:http://www.ltesting.net